WebTHURSDAY, March 23, 2024 (HealthDay News) -- Ask your teen about their day and try to spend more quality time together. It matters, a new study found. Teens who report better relationships with their moms and dads are healthier both mentally and physically and less likely to abuse drugs or alcohol as young adults, according to researchers. WebApr 3, 2024 · Investigators from the U.S. Centers for Disease Control and Prevention and Food and Drug Administration have identified 12 illnesses and three hospitalizations occurring across 11 states. Reported illnesses started on Dec. 6 and continued through Feb. 13. Those sickened are mostly female and range from 12 to 81 years old. WebApr 11, 2024 · Move to 'green' school buses could boost kids' class attendance. Outdated buses actually wind up costing kids many days of education, thanks to the clouds of diesel exhaust left in their wake, a new study argues.
